Explores a curious lawsuit regarding the buried treasure of renowned Pirate Captain Kidd and a cast of characters from Cotton Mather Fredrick Law Olmsted Lady Dunmore John Jacob Astor. Photographic illustrations reproduce several paintings frontispiece shows John Jacob Astor dressed in the regalia of a Fur Trapper of 1813 and there is also a reproduction of a letter from F.L. Olmsted. A new issue of the minor classic story by Franklin H. Head founder of the Chicago Liars Club telling the tale of Frederick Law Olmsted"s $5000000 lawsuit against John Jacob Astor in 1898 for his theft of the Pirate Captain Kidd's treasure. A hoax that has at various times been taken as true. The colophon is inaccurate: the 400 "trade edition" copies were never printed and only 50 of the 100 listed hand-bound copies on hand-made paper were printed. Tight bright and unmarrd. About The Book: A Second Handful of Popular Maxims Current in Sanskrit Literature by George Adolphus Jacob continues his exploration of classical Sanskrit wisdom through a curated collection of maxims drawn from ancient texts. Each saying is presented in its original Sanskrit accompanied by English translation and explanatory commentary. The work highlights moral philosophical and practical teachings prevalent in Indian culture offering insight into the values and thought systems of traditional Hindu society. Designed for students scholars and admirers of Sanskrit literature this volume deepens understanding of India's intellectual heritage and reflects Jacob�s scholarly effort to make Eastern wisdom accessible to Western audiences. About The Author: George Adolphus Jacob 1846�1918 was a British scholar and Indologist known for his deep engagement with Sanskrit literature and Hindu philosophy. His major works include A Handful of Popular Maxims Current in Sanskrit Literature where he compiled and interpreted widely known Sanskrit aphorisms offering insights into Indian ethical and cultural thought. He also translated and analyzed key philosophical texts such as The Vedantasara in A Manual of Hindu Pantheism and the Mahanarayana-Upanishad. His Concordance to the Principal Upanishads and Bhagavadgt is a valuable reference for scholars. Jacob's works bridged Indian philosophical traditions and Western scholarship with clarity and respect.
